Health CEO's plan to tackle coronavirus outbreak
The interim CEO of the Department of Health and Social Care has spoken out about the Isle of Man Government's plan to tackle the coronavirus outbreak.
Kathryn Magson was one of a number of government representatives appearing at a press briefing this morning.
